The diverse range of produce for sale will include vegetable seedlings, fruit, vegetables,, plants and flowers, beautiful home -baked goods (including famous Nethercote cakes and quiches), jams & sauces, plus grass-fed beef, free-range chooks and eggs and smoked fish. While most of the stallholders are Nethercotians, the only stipulation is that produce comes from within 250ks of Bega. Seed funding is available for anyone who wishes to grow specifically towards future markets; no obligation or risk and "no worries" if the crop fails.
